The forum will be held from 7 to 8 p.m. at the UConn-Stamford campus in the Gen Re Auditorium, 1 University Place, Stamford.
Residents who would like an opportunity to ask the aovernor a question should arrive about 30 minutes prior to the start of the event to submit their name on a sign-up sheet.
The forum is open to the public.
The Stamford event will be the first stop in a series of town hall forums that the Malloy and Wyman will be holding throughout the 2016 legislative session.
The event will be similar to those they have held in previous years, where they answered hundreds of questions on a range of state issues at numerous forums.
Dates and locations for additional town hall forums in the series will be announced during the coming weeks.
